Metabolite content in LA3913 fruit at stage of red ripe
Experiment: flavor related metabolite profiling in S. habrochaites IL lines (FL, Spring 2006, Greenhouse)


metabolitecontent relative level (percent of control)
2-methyl-1-butanol 2.0657 ± 0.7937 (ng/gfw/hr)15.5
cis-2-penten-1-ol 0.169 ± 0.08658 (ng/gfw/hr)22
methional 0.0514 ± 0.0137 (ng/gfw/hr)27.7
beta damascenone 0.0033 ± 0.00079 (ng/gfw/hr)30.9
3-methyl-1-butanol 17.4841 ± 8.96768 (ng/gfw/hr)31.3
benzaldehyde 1.3213 ± 0.27165 (ng/gfw/hr)34.6
3-methylbutanal 9.2025 ± 4.32015 (ng/gfw/hr)40.9
1-penten-3-one 0.2102 ± 0.03846 (ng/gfw/hr)42.4
methyl salicylate 0.0391 ± 0.00456 (ng/gfw/hr)43.3
isovaleronitrile 12.4471 ± 2.5547 (ng/gfw/hr)44.9
cis-3-hexenal 14.5088 ± 3.93392 (ng/gfw/hr)48.6
pentanal 2.7934 ± 0.43527 (ng/gfw/hr)48.9
2-methylbutanal 1.4032 ± 0.2731 (ng/gfw/hr)49.3
1-pentanol 1.7599 ± 0.31266 (ng/gfw/hr)52.7
methyl jasmonate 0.0061 ± 0.00135 (ng/gfw/hr)57.2
1-penten-3-ol 2.3038 ± 0.46793 (ng/gfw/hr)58.6
trans-2-pentenal 0.2214 ± 0.05632 (ng/gfw/hr)63.9
beta ionone 0.0149 ± 0.00331 (ng/gfw/hr)67.2
1-nitro-2-phenylethane 0.3663 ± 0.09331 (ng/gfw/hr)82.1
cis-3-hexen-1-ol 22.2154 ± 3.94352 (ng/gfw/hr)84.8
hexanal 103.734 ± 19.2082 (ng/gfw/hr)91.1
2-isobutylthiazole 4.5741 ± 0.81674 (ng/gfw/hr)102.2
6-methyl-5-hepten-2-one 9.1131 ± 1.265 (ng/gfw/hr)117.7
trans-2-hexenal 0.6961 ± 0.24214 (ng/gfw/hr)123.4
hexyl alcohol 36.5617 ± 4.87758 (ng/gfw/hr)132.4
2-phenylethanol 0.1242 ± 0.05389 (ng/gfw/hr)176.4
geranylacetone 1.8742 ± 0.42782 (ng/gfw/hr)196.6
geranial 0.0627 ± 0.00988 (ng/gfw/hr)215.8
trans-2-heptenal 0.4868 ± 0.23186 (ng/gfw/hr)249.9
methyl benzoate 0.5179 ± 0.30226 (ng/gfw/hr)264.1
phenylacetaldehyde 0.2551 ± 0.08784 (ng/gfw/hr)309.9
benzyl alcohol 0.8107 ± 0.48471 (ng/gfw/hr)418.3
isobutyl acetate 7.3605 ± 2.83428 (ng/gfw/hr)670.1
2-methoxyphenol 2.1238 ± 1.01906 (ng/gfw/hr)768.6
